Prioritise welfare of citizens, Ajimobi tells Ogun governor-elect
Gov. Abiola Ajimobi of Oyo State has advised the Ogun governor-elect, Mr Dapo Abiodun, to prioritise the welfare of the people of his state as compensation for their overwhelming support.
A statement by Ajimobi’s spokesman, Bolaji Tunji, said the governor gave the advice when Abiodun visited the Oyo State governor in Ibadan on Sunday.
Ajimobi thanked the people of Ogun for electing Abiodun, urging the governor-elect to see his election as a rare opportunity to serve his people and better their lots.
The governor, who congratulated Abiodun, described him as gentle, kind-hearted and an epitome of humility.
“When my brother, Dapo Abiodun, intimated me of his intention to contest for the Ogun governorship election, I told him that he should go ahead and that he will be victorious by the grace of God.
“I therefore thank God that today he has become the governor-elect of Ogun. I have every cause to glorify God on his behalf.
“In the affairs of men, God has always been present. It is this divine presence that has brought him this victory.
“Dapo is gentle, kind-hearted and an epitome of humility. All these he has demonstrated here today through this visit.
“While I’m congratulating you on this victory, let me state that an opportunity to serve is an opportunity to be Godly.
“You must do everything humanly possible to prioritise the welfare of your people as a compensation for the overwhelming support they gave you to emerge governor-elect,” he said.
Ajimobi urged Abiodun to be ready and prepared to step on toes towards recording meaningful achievements as well as making the desired change during his tenure.
“If you want to be a good leader and make a change, you must be ready and prepared to step on toes. When you step on toes, the toes will kick you back. Just forge ahead.
“If you really want to make a change, study your environment; have courage, not only to envision but also to make a difference.
“Put Godliness above all things and ensure that whatever you do is in the best interest of the people.
“While I will tell you that you should not under-estimate your enemies, let me, however, say that you should not be deterred by their antics. You can lose a battle but you must win the war.
“You will have sycophants along the way but you must remain focussed. I have no doubt that with the level of your intellectual disposition, you will succeed,” he said.
The governor said notwithstanding his defeat at the Oyo South senatorial district election, he had not lost anything other than the opportunity to serve his people.
According to him,”when I look at my life, I can say without any equivocation that God has been so kind to me.
“He gave me the opportunity to serve as a senator and as governor of Oyo State for two consecutive terms.
“For me, that I did not win does not mean that I have lost everything. In fact, I must say that I have not lost anything.
“Rather, I have only lost the opportunity to serve my people again and give them good representation at the Senate.
For us in Oyo State, it is joy.
“God has been so good to us. We have served commendably. We have succeeded in not only providing peace and security, we have also promoted the socio-economic well-being of our people,” Ajimobi added.
Earlier, Abiodun said the purpose of the visit was to thank Ajimobi for his support during the election and to seek his “wise counsel.”
Abiodun said that ‘some forces’ did everything possible to scuttle his victory, adding that God, in His infinite mercy, had given him the grace to win.
The governor-elect commended Ajimobi, whom he described as his very good brother, for staying with him since he started the journey.
Abiodun said that he was extremely pained when he heard of Ajimobi’s defeat, saying his monumental achievements as governor would remain indelible.
“Things like these happen some times which you find extremely difficult to explain. But, you are a good man. You are the father of modern Oyo state.
“You have turned the fortunes of the state around and I am sure that posterity will judge you right,” he said.
On Abiodun’s entourage were the deputy governor-elect, Mrs Noimot Salako-Oyedele; Sen. Lanre Tejuoso and a former Deputy Governor of the state, Prince Segun Adesegun.
Also on the entourage were Mr Tunde Osibodu, Mr Tunde Osinowo and Mr Afolabi Salisu, among others.

HON. JA’AFARU YAKUBU HONOURED WITH DOUBLE TRADITIONAL TITLES OF CHIROMAN GASSOL AND MARAFAN BAKUNDI BALI
The Member representing Bali/Gassol Federal Constituency in the House of Representatives, Hon. Ja’afaru Chiroma Yakubu (ADC), has been conferred with two prestigious traditional titles — Chiroman Gassol and Marafan Bakundi Bali — in recognition of his exemplary leadership, commitment to public service, and immense contributions to community development.
The traditional honours were officially bestowed on the federal lawmaker by the revered traditional ruler of Bakundi Chiefdom, His Royal Highness, Alhaji Kabiru Muhammad Gidado Misa, the 10th Lamdo of Bakundi, during a colourful coronation ceremony attended by members of the royal family, community leaders, political associates, supporters, and well-wishers.
The conferment of the dual traditional titles has continued to attract widespread commendation from stakeholders across Taraba State and beyond, with many describing the recognition as a reflection of Hon. Ja’afaru Yakubu’s growing influence, grassroots connection, and unwavering dedication to the wellbeing of his people.
In a congratulatory message issued by his Special Assistant on Media and Publicity, Comrade Bashir Umar Dali, the lawmaker was described as a courageous, humble, and visionary leader whose commitment to humanity and community advancement has remained outstanding.
According to the statement, the titles Chiroman Gassol and Marafan Bakundi Bali are symbolic recognitions of the lawmaker’s selfless service, people-oriented representation, and tireless efforts towards promoting unity, peace, and sustainable development across Bali/Gassol Federal Constituency.
The statement further noted that Hon. Ja’afaru Yakubu has consistently distinguished himself through impactful representation, empowerment initiatives, and developmental interventions aimed at improving the lives of the people.
“Your commitment and selfless contributions to the growth and progress of the people continue to inspire many across Bali/Gassol Federal Constituency and beyond,” the statement read.
Comrade Bashir Umar Dali also prayed for greater wisdom, strength, honour, and divine guidance for the federal lawmaker as he continues to shoulder greater traditional and leadership responsibilities in service to the people.
Observers have described the conferment of the two traditional titles as a major endorsement of Hon. Ja’afaru Yakubu’s leadership credentials and his increasing relevance in the socio-political and traditional landscape of Taraba State.
The titles Chiroman Gassol and Marafan Bakundi Bali are regarded as highly respected honours within the traditional institution, reserved for individuals who have demonstrated exceptional character, loyalty, service, and commitment to the development and unity of their communities.

EID-EL-KABIR: BELLO BABAYO BELLO COMMENDS TINUBU, SHETTIMA, GOMBE GOVERNOR AS HE FELICITATES WITH MUSLIMS NATIONWIDE
The Executive Director, Networks, Niger Delta Power Holding Company Limited (NDPHC), Engr. Bello Babayo Bello, FNSE, has extended warm felicitations to Muslim faithful across Nigeria, particularly the people of Gombe State, on the occasion of the 2026 Eid-el-Kabir celebration, urging citizens to continue promoting peace, unity, love, and national development.
In a goodwill message released to journalists on the occasion of the Islamic festival, Engr. Bello described Eid-el-Kabir as a sacred celebration that reflects the virtues of sacrifice, obedience, faith, compassion, and gratitude to Almighty Allah as demonstrated by Prophet Ibrahim (AS).
He called on Muslims to use the spiritual significance of the season to strengthen the bonds of brotherhood, support one another, and continue praying for the peace, stability, and prosperity of Nigeria.
Engr. Bello also commended the leadership of President Bola Ahmed Tinubu, GCFR, for his commitment to national development, economic reforms, infrastructural advancement, and efforts aimed at strengthening unity and progress across the country.
According to him, the administration of President Tinubu has continued to demonstrate determination in laying foundations for long-term growth and national transformation through bold policies and strategic governance initiatives.
The NDPHC Executive Director equally praised Vice President Kashim Shettima, GCON, for his loyalty, dedication, and support toward the actualization of the Renewed Hope Agenda of the Federal Government.
He noted that the Vice President has continued to play a vital role in promoting stability, inclusion, and effective coordination within government.
Engr. Bello further applauded the Governor of Gombe State, Muhammadu Inuwa Yahaya, CON, for what he described as purposeful leadership and remarkable strides in infrastructural development, healthcare, education, youth empowerment, and peaceful coexistence in the state.
He said the governor’s developmental policies and inclusive style of governance have continued to attract admiration and confidence from the people of Gombe State and beyond.
“Eid-el-Kabir remains a season of reflection, gratitude, sacrifice, and devotion to Almighty Allah. It is also a period that reminds us of the importance of unity, compassion, tolerance, and service to humanity. As we celebrate, we must continue to pray for our leaders and for the continued peace, progress, and prosperity of our dear nation,” he stated.
Engr. Bello urged Muslim faithful to extend love and kindness to the less privileged, widows, orphans, and vulnerable members of society during the Sallah festivities, stressing that charity and generosity are central teachings of Islam.
He also commended the people of Gombe State for sustaining the culture of peaceful coexistence, harmony, and mutual respect among diverse communities.
The engineering professional and public administrator expressed optimism that Nigeria would continue to witness greater development, unity, and economic advancement under the leadership of President Tinubu.
He prayed for Allah’s continued guidance, wisdom, protection, and blessings upon the President, Vice President, Governor Inuwa Yahaya, and all leaders across the country.
Engr. Bello finally wished Muslim faithful in Gombe State and across Nigeria a peaceful, joyous, and spiritually fulfilling Eid-el-Kabir celebration.

Dogara Celebrates Eid El-Adha, Urges Nigerians to Embrace Unity, Sacrifice, and Compassion
Rt. Hon. Yakubu Dogara, former Speaker of the House of Representatives and Chairman of the Board of National Credit Guarantee Company Limited (NCGC), has extended heartfelt felicitations to Muslims across Nigeria and around the world on the occasion of Eid El-Adha.
In his Eid message, Dogara described the festival as one of the most profound moments in the Islamic faith — a sacred season that embodies the enduring virtues of sacrifice, obedience, faith, and total devotion to God, as demonstrated by Prophet Ibrahim (AS). He noted that beyond its spiritual significance, Eid El-Adha serves as a powerful reminder of the values of compassion, generosity, and love for humanity.
According to him, the celebration offers an opportunity for reflection and renewal, urging Nigerians to recommit themselves to the ideals of unity, peace, and mutual understanding. He observed that the true essence of Eid lies not merely in celebration, but in the willingness to serve others selflessly and uplift the less privileged.
“Eid El-Adha reminds us that greatness is found in sacrifice, service, and compassion for one another. It is a season that calls us to strengthen the bonds of brotherhood, extend kindness to those in need, and renew hope for a better and more united nation,” Dogara stated.
The former Speaker stressed that the lessons of Eid should transcend religious and ethnic boundaries, especially at a time when Nigeria needs collective commitment to peace, justice, and national cohesion. He called on citizens to rise above division and work together in the spirit of patriotism and shared destiny.
“As we celebrate this sacred festival, may the spirit of sacrifice inspire us to build bridges of understanding, promote harmony across our communities, and work collectively for a more peaceful, just, and prosperous Nigeria,” he added.
Dogara further prayed that the blessings of Eid El-Adha would bring joy to families, healing to communities, and progress to the nation. He encouraged the faithful to use the occasion as a time for spiritual renewal, deeper devotion to God, stronger family ties, and renewed commitment to the common good.
“As families gather in prayer and celebration, may this Eid remind us of our shared humanity and our collective responsibility to serve with humility, love, and sincerity. May the Almighty accept our prayers and sacrifices, bless our homes with peace and happiness, and guide our nation toward greater unity and prosperity,” he concluded.
Dogara wished all Muslim faithful a peaceful and joyous Eid El-Adha celebration filled with divine blessings, love, hope, and renewed faith in the future of Nigeria.
